Their keynote underscored why silicon spin qubits stand out as a premier candidate for scalable quantum systems, capitalizing on the robustness of mature semiconductor manufacturing processes 🛠️. Dr. Vinet and Dr. Daval shared the latest breakthroughs in quantum technology, and expertly showcased FDSOI CMOS technology as a practical and promising platform for the seamless co-integration of spin qubits with control and read-out circuits 💡.
